Welcome to the Terraquill team. Our field-survey app's offline mode caches forms and map layers locally, encrypted per device. When a surveyor's device is replaced, cached data is recovered through the Brackenhill sync console, which requires the shared recovery credential. New hires should memorize it from the line that follows.

unlock words, hafop-tahog: drumir-druiel-kasox-wenax-tamys-frair

Runbook: Harvestlink Gateway restart

The Harvestlink gateway buffers tractor telemetry in a local queue before forwarding to the ingest tier. On restart, verify the queue drains within two minutes; if it stalls, check the MQTT bridge first, not the forwarder. Do not clear the buffer manually — data loss is unrecoverable. The service reads the following configuration at boot.

deployment values, yahag-tawef:
ZORWYN_HOST=zorwyn.tolvaqlabs.internal
ZORWYN_PORT=9300

## Bulk Edits in the Admin Table (Cobblewick Console)

Heads up, reviewer: bulk edits in the Cobblewick admin table don't go through the usual per-row validation hooks — they hit a batch endpoint that validates server-side only. So if a PR touches the batch path, check the validator coverage, not the UI. Testing bulk edits against staging requires the elevated admin role, which is unlocked with a recovery passphrase. The current one is right below.

vault phrase of taweg-kafof = oliax-zorael

Handover: nightly search reindex (Marrowlight)

Hey future maintainer — the nightly reindex is mostly boring now, which took effort. It kicks off after the analytics rollup finishes, walks the catalog in shard order, and swaps the alias at the end. If it dies midway, just rerun it; the swap is atomic so users never see a half-built index. Watch the heap on the indexer box during big catalog weeks. The job reads these configuration values at startup:

service settings:
[casax]
port = 6379
team = rusir
host = casax.zemvarhq.corp
region = outer-4
access_code = ac_9808ce
timeout_ms = 1500